§ 1129. Interagency cooperation

Each department, agency, or other instrumentality of the Federal Government which is engaged in or concerned with, or which has authority over, matters relating to ocean, coastal, and Great Lakes resources—
(1)may, upon a written request from the Secretary, make available, on a reimbursable basis or otherwise any personnel (with their consent and without prejudice to their position and rating), service, or facility which the Secretary deems necessary to carry out any provision of this subchapter;
(2)shall, upon a written request from the Secretary, furnish any available data or other information which the Secretary deems necessary to carry out any provision of this subchapter; and
(3)shall cooperate with the Administration and duly authorized officials thereof.
(Pub. L. 89–454, title II, § 210, as added Pub. L. 94–461, § 2, Oct. 8, 1976, 90 Stat. 1968; amended Pub. L. 100–220, title III, § 3104(b)(1)(G), Dec. 29, 1987, 101 Stat. 1471.)
